Transaction 137193cba21fe05871e7b763e1e43fba7dc6648d3330078d6a3c0f8389864920
1 Input
1 Output
-
137193cba21fe05871e7b763e1e43fba7dc6648d3330078d6a3c0f8389864920:0
- value
- 157851347
- script pubkey
- OP_0 OP_PUSHBYTES_20 ae891fdefff3de4f049391256e9ab1a6623fee98
- address
- bc1q46y3lhhl700y7pynjyjkax435e3rlm5cmhxypk